Delphi数据库开发关键技术与实例应用

Delphi数据库开发关键技术与实例应用 PDF 完整清晰版

  • 大小:119.53MB
  • 类型:Delphi
  • 格式:PDF
  • 热度:534
  • 作者:明日科技,赛奎春,陈紫鸿,宋坤
  • 更新:2022-06-18 17:04:58
vip 立即下载( 119.53MB )
关注公众号免费下载
版权投诉 / 资源反馈(本资源由用户 詹元甲 投稿)

本书从Delphi用户经常遇到的问题入手,结合应用实例的讲解,帮助读者快速掌握使用Delphi开发数据库管理系统的关键技术、方法和技巧,从而开发出适合企业应用的数据库系统。 全书共分为13章,内容包括如何使用代码设计SQL Server数据库、如何连接数据库、数据集与数据访问组件应用技巧、数据输入输出技术、常用控制组件应用技术、SQL数据查询技术、设计报表和图表、软件与数据库安全、计算机外围硬件程序设计、数据库典型程序设计、多层结构程序开发设计、SQL Server 2000开发设计、使用InstallShield制作安装程序。 本书配套光盘中提供了书中应用实例的源程序代码,所有源程序均在Windows 98或Windows XP下调试通过,确保能够正常运行。本书内容精练、重点突出,适合Delphi程序开发人员阅读和参考,也可供大中专院校计算机相关专业的师生学习。 目录 章 使用代码设计SQL Server数据库 1 1.1 如何使用代码创建数据库 1 1.2 如何使用代码定义表和字段 4 1.3 如何使用代码定义索引 6 1.4 如何使用代码创建存储过程 8 1.5 如何使用代码创建触发器 11 1.6 如何使用代码压缩数据库 14 1.7 如何使用代码分离数据库 16 1.8 如何使用代码附加数据库 17 第2章 如何连接数据库 20 2.1 如何使用BDE访问Paradox数据库 20 2.2 如何使用BDE访问Access和FoxPro数据库 25 2.3 如何使用BDE访问SQL Server数据库 29 2.4 如何动态创建ODBC数据源 32 2.5 如何使用ODBC连接SQL Server数据库 35 2.6 如何使用ADO访问Paradox数据库 39 2.7 如何使用ADO访问Access数据库 42 2.8 如何使用ADO访问带有密码的Access数据库 45 第3章 数据集与数据访问组件应用技巧 49 3.1 利用TDatabase组件去掉注册对话框 49 3.2 对数据表的字段进行计算 52 3.3 使用TTable组件的Filter方法动态过滤数据 55 3.4 利用Locate进行多个字段动态搜索 57 3.5 如何在TQuery组件中赋值和运行SQL 60 3.6 如何在TQuery中赋值变量 63 3.7 在TQuery组件中组装SQL实现动态查询 65 3.8 如何利用TADOTable组件设计主从明细表 68 3.9 如何使用TADOQuery组件设计主从明细表 70 3.10 如何利用TADODataSet对象批量更新数据 73 第4章 数据库输入输出技术 78 4.1 使用数据控制组件实现数据记录的添加和修改 78 4.2 使用非数据组件实现数据记录的添加和修改 81 4.3 在数据输入时验证数据是否合法 85 4.4 在数据输入时检测输入是否重复并提示 89 4.5 对组件内数据进行数据格式化处理 92 4.6 利用日期组件实现日期录入 96 4.7 在数据输入时自动切换输入法 98 4.8 利用键盘Enter、、实现组件间的灵活跳转 101 4.9 如何自动生成产品编号 105 4.10 利用组件数组实现数据的录入 108 4.11 如何保存图片数据到数据库 111 4.12 如何获得汉字的拼音简码 113 第5章 常用控制组件应用技术 117 5.1 如何将字段内容添加到TComboBox组件中 117 5.2 利用TDBGrid组件实现字段间计算 120 5.3 在TDBGrid单元格中显示图片数据 123 5.4 在TDBGrid组件中显示多数据表数据 125 5.5 在程序运行时设置TStringGrid组件行列 128 5.6 在程序中设置TStringGrid组件颜色 131 5.7 使用TTreeView实现数据库的树状显示 134 5.8 使用TListView实现数据库的图形显示 137 5.9 在程序运行时对TStringGrid单元格数据进行计算 140 5.10 利用TStringGrid实现表单式输入数据 144 5.11 使用TDBCtrlGrid组件实现分栏显示数据 150 5.12 利用决策组组件统计分析数据 152 第6章 SQL数据查询技术 157 6.1 利用WHERE参数过滤数据 157 6.2 使用通配符进行模糊查询 160 6.3 利用关键字DISTINCT去除重复记录 163 6.4 使用AND、OR和NOT进行复合条件查询 166 6.5 在查询程序中使用常量 168 6.6 在查询程序中使用组件 171 6.7 如何对某一区间数据进行查询 174 6.8 如何对日期数据进行查询 176 6.9 利用聚集函数对数据进行汇总 179 6.10 如何将查询结果分组小计 182 6.11 如何对查询结果进行排序 185 6.12 追加查询结果到已存在表 187 6.13 对数据库数据进行局部更新 190 6.14 对数据库数据进行局部删除 192 6.15 如何将查询结果生成新表 194 第7章 设计报表和图表 197 7.1 利用报表生成器生成报表 197 7.2 设计标签式报表 201 7.3 设计汇款单式报表 206 7.4 设计分组式报表 209 7.5 设计主明细式报表 213 7.6 设计图案式报表 217 7.7 利用Excel打印报表 220 7.8 设计与修改图表 227 第8章 软件与数据库安全技术 232 8.1 如何设置对Access数据库的访问权限 232 8.2 如何利用INI文件对软件进行注册 235 8.3 如何利用注册表设计软件注册程序 237 8.4 如何跟踪操作员操作 240 8.5 为不同用户设置读写权限 247 8.6 如何设计软件试

相关资源

  • Grafana使用手册中文版(基础)

    Grafana使用手册是一套grafana的基础使用手册中文版, 详细讲解Grafana从安装到调试整个过程,并通过完整的示例,带你一步一步实现grafana配置,帮你尽快上手Grafana。 可视化技术设施性能数据和应用分析序列数据,监控数据和日志数据分析展示分析聚合展示。 Grafana是一款用Go语言开发的开源数据可视化工具,可以做数据监控和数据统计,带有告警功能。目前使用grafana的公司有很多,如paypal、ebay、intel等。Grafana也应用于基它领域,包括工业传感器,家庭自

    大小:2.7 MBGrafana手册

  • C++大学基础教程

    C++大学基础教程 课后答案

    本书是适应计算机技术发展和教学改革需要而编写的大学程序设计课程新教材。 本书共13章。前7章覆盖了C++基本程序设计的内容,后6章讲述了C++面向对象程序设计的思想和基本方法。教材中对于C++中非常重要的指针、引用、封装、继承、多态和异常处理等都作了详细而清晰的叙述。 教材的编写目的是为学生打好程序设计的基础,因此,特别注意在介绍基本概念和基本方法的同时,重视良好编程习惯的培养。 本书适合作大学程序设计课程的教材或专门的

    大小:8.47 MBC++教程课后答案

  • 软件工程实践者的研究方法(第七版)

    软件工程实践者的研究方法(第七版) 课后答案

    软件工程:实践者的研究方法(原书第7版)自近30年前第1版问世以来,在软件工程界始终发挥着巨大而深远的影响,其权威性是公认的、无可置疑的。第7版绝不是前一版的简单更新,它包含了很多新的内容,而且调整了全书的结构,以改进教学顺序,同时更加强调一些新的、重要的软件工程过程和软件工程实践知识。全书分软件过程、建模、质量管理、软件项目管理和软件工程高级课题五个部分,系统地论述了软件工程领域最新的基础知识,包括新的概念、

    大小:76 KB软件工程课后答案

  • 《Unity 2018入门与实战》源码文件

    《Unity 2018入门与实战》源码文件

    编辑推荐 初学者也能快速上手!n 简单有趣的说明和插图,趣味讲解如何制作游戏n 游戏开发书里的小清新。全书用一只卡通形象的小猫贯穿讲解,风趣幽默,极具可读性。n n 1.讲解C# 基础知识,零基础也能轻松开始学习;n 2.演练五大步骤,让游戏开发设计有章可循;n 3.制作六个游戏,循序渐进掌握Unity游戏开发。 内容简介 本书基于Unity 2018,用简单的说明和插图详细介绍了如何开发游戏。本书在讲解时将游戏开发分解为5 个步骤,并通过6 个小游戏的开

    大小:629 KBUnity配套资源

  • 《计算机英语》习题,教案

    《计算机英语》习题,教案

    内容介绍 本书是为培养计算机人才的专业英语能力而编写的教材。主要内容包括:计算机硬件和软件基础、外部设备、操作系统、数据结构、C语言、数据库、面向对象编程、计算机网络、因特网及相关技术、多媒体、人工智能、网络安全以及计算机病毒等。 全书以Unit为单位,每个Unit由以下几部分组成:课文选材广泛、风格多样、切合实际;单词给出课文中出现的新词,读者由此可以积累专业的基本词汇;常用词组给出本单元所涉及的常用词组;难句

    大小:341.80 KB计算机英语配套资源

  • 《计算机操作与应用(Windows XP+Office 2007)》素材,教案

    《计算机操作与应用(Windows XP+Office 2007)》素材,教案

    编辑推荐 《计算机操作与应用(Windows XP+Office 2007)》注重中职学校的授课情况及学生的认知特点,在内容上加大了与实际应用相结合案例的编写比例,突出基础知识、基本技能,软件版本均采用*中文版。为了满足不同学校的教学要求,《计算机操作与应用(Windows XP+Office 2007)》采用了两种编写风格。 内容简介 本书采用项目式编写方式,共设十五个项目。项目一至项目三介绍Windows XP中文版操作系统的基本概念以及Windows XP专业版的使用,包括Windows XP中基本

    大小:14.57 MB计算机操作配套资源

  • 数据库应用技术 SQL Server 2005篇(第二版)

    数据库应用技术 SQL Server 2005篇(第二版) 课后答案

    本书以Microsoft公司的SQL Server 2005数据库系统为平台,采用项目驱动式的教材编写思想,介绍了SQL Server 2005数据库系统的安装、配置、管理和使用方法,并以网上订单管理系统的开发作为教材的载体,详细讲述关系数据库系统的基本原理和数据库应用技术,并介绍了ASP.NET的数据库应用开发实例。 本书本着理论与实践一体化的原则,注重数据库应用的实际训练,紧跟数据库应用技术的新发展,使学生能够及时、准确地掌握数据库应用的新知识。 本书适合作

    大小:944 KB数据库应用课后答案

  • 管理信息系统(第5版)

    管理信息系统(第5版) 课后答案

    本书全面介绍了管理信息系统的概念、结构、技术、应用及其对组织和社会的影响。本书分为四篇:第一篇介绍管理信息系统的定义、概念、结构,以及管理、信息、系统的基本知识。第二篇介绍信息技术,包括:计算机硬件、软件、网络和数据库的原理、概念和应用。第三篇介绍应用系统,包括职能、层次、流程、行业和决策信息系统。第四篇介绍信息系统的建设和管理,包括:信息系统的规划,信息系统的分析、设计、实施、管理,还介绍了信息道

    大小:9.02 MB信息管理课后答案

下载地址

相关声明:

学习笔记